Evolution of Crystal Awards:
The concept of using crystal awards to recognize achievements began to take shape in the late 19th century. The Victorian era marked a resurgence of interest in decorative arts, and crystal became a favored medium for crafting trophies and awards. The ability to mold crystal into various shapes and sizes allowed for the creation of stunning, bespoke awards that could be tailored to commemorate specific accomplishments.
One pivotal moment in the evolution of crystal awards was the introduction of lead crystal. The addition of lead to the glass composition enhanced its refractive properties, resulting in a brilliance that surpassed regular glass. Renowned manufacturers like Waterford Crystal and Baccarat embraced lead crystal, setting a new standard for the production of high-quality crystal awards.
The Artistry Behind Crystal Awards:
Crafting a crystal award is an intricate process that requires precision and skill. Skilled artisans employ traditional techniques like hand-cutting and engraving to bring out the inherent beauty of crystal. Each cut reflects light in a unique way, adding depth and dimension to the award. The artistry involved in the creation of crystal awards elevates them from mere trophies to works of art that capture the essence of achievement.
